A documentation rendering engine built with Vue 3, Quasar v2 and Vite. Transform Markdown into beautiful, navigable documentation sites.

Readme

Transform Markdown content into beautiful, navigable documentation sites — with i18n, syntax highlighting, dark/light mode, and anchor navigation.


✨ Features

  • 📝 Markdown Rendering — Write docs in Markdown, rendered with syntax highlighting (Prism.js)
  • 🌍 Internationalization (i18n) — Multi-language support with HJSON locale files and per-page translations
  • 🌗 Dark/Light Mode — Automatic theme switching with Quasar Dark Plugin
  • 🔗 Anchor Navigation — Right-side Table of Contents tree with scroll tracking
  • 🔎 Search — Menu search across all documentation content and tags
  • 📱 Responsive — Mobile-friendly with collapsible sidebar and drawers
  • 🏷️ Status Badges — Mark pages as done, draft, or empty with visual indicators
  • ✏️ Edit on GitHub — Direct links to edit pages on your repository
  • 📊 Translation Progress — Automatic translation percentage based on header coverage
  • ⚙️ Single Config File — Customize branding, links, and languages via docsector.config.js

🚀 Quick Start

📦 Install

npm install @docsector/docsector-reader

🏗️ Scaffold a new project

npx docsector init my-docs
cd my-docs
npm install

This creates a minimal project with quasar.config.js, docsector.config.js, src/pages/, src/i18n/, and public/ — all powered by the docsector-reader engine.

💻 Development

npx docsector dev
# or
npx quasar dev

🏭 Production Build

npx docsector build
npx docsector serve    # Preview production build

📐 Architecture — Library Mode

Docsector Reader works as a rendering engine: it provides the layout, components, router, store, and boot files. Consumer projects supply only their content (pages, i18n, config, assets).

┌───────────────────────────────────────────────────────┐
│  Consumer project (your-docs/)                        │
│  ├── docsector.config.js   ← branding, links, langs  │
│  ├── quasar.config.js      ← thin wrapper            │
│  ├── src/pages/            ← Markdown + route defs    │
│  ├── src/i18n/             ← language files + tags    │
│  └── public/               ← logo, images, icons     │
│                                                       │
│  ┌───────────────────────────────────────────────┐    │
│  │  @docsector/docsector-reader (engine)         │    │
│  │  ├── App.vue, router, store, boot files       │    │
│  │  ├── DPage, DMenu, DH1–DH6, DefaultLayout    │    │
│  │  ├── composables (useNavigator)               │    │
│  │  └── CSS, Prism.js, QZoom                     │    │
│  └───────────────────────────────────────────────┘    │
└───────────────────────────────────────────────────────┘

Consumer quasar.config.js

The consumer's Quasar config is a thin wrapper around the factory:

import { configure, createQuasarConfig } from '@docsector/docsector-reader/quasar-factory'

export default configure(() => {
  return createQuasarConfig({
    projectRoot: import.meta.dirname,

    // Optional: consumer-specific boot files (resolved from src/boot/)
    boot: ['qmediaplayer'],

    // Optional: PWA manifest overrides
    pwa: {
      name: 'My Docs',
      short_name: 'Docs',
      theme_color: '#027be3'
    },

    // Optional: extra Vite plugins
    vitePlugins: [],

    // Optional: extend Vite config further
    extendViteConf (viteConf) {
      // custom aliases, plugins, etc.
    }
  })
})

How aliases work

| Alias | Standalone | Consumer mode | |---|---|---| | components | project src/components/ | package src/components/ | | layouts | project src/layouts/ | package src/layouts/ | | boot | project src/boot/ | package src/boot/ | | composables | project src/composables/ | package src/composables/ | | css | project src/css/ | package src/css/ | | stores | project src/store/ | package src/store/ | | pages | project src/pages/ | consumer src/pages/ | | src/i18n | project src/i18n/ | consumer src/i18n/ | | docsector.config.js | project root | consumer root | | @docsector/tags | project src/i18n/tags.hjson | consumer src/i18n/tags.hjson |


⚙️ Configuration (docsector.config.js)

export default {
  branding: {
    logo: '/images/logo/my-logo.png',
    name: 'My Project',
    version: 'v1.0.0',
    versions: ['v1.0.0', 'v0.9.0']
  },

  links: {
    github: 'https://github.com/org/repo',
    discussions: 'https://github.com/org/repo/discussions',
    chat: 'https://discord.gg/invite',
    email: '[email protected]',
    changelog: 'https://github.com/org/repo/releases',
    roadmap: 'https://github.com/org/repo/blob/main/ROADMAP.md',
    sponsor: 'https://github.com/sponsors/user',
    explore: [
      { label: '🌟 Related Project', url: 'https://github.com/org/related' }
    ]
  },

  github: {
    editBaseUrl: 'https://github.com/org/repo/edit/main/src/pages'
  },

  languages: [
    { image: '/images/flags/united-states-of-america.png', label: 'English (US)', value: 'en-US' },
    { image: '/images/flags/brazil.png', label: 'Português (BR)', value: 'pt-BR' }
  ],

  defaultLanguage: 'en-US'
}

🌍 Internationalization

i18n setup (src/i18n/index.js)

Consumer projects use the buildMessages helper from the engine:

import { buildMessages } from '@docsector/docsector-reader/i18n'

const langModules = import.meta.glob('./languages/*.hjson', { eager: true })
const mdModules = import.meta.glob('../pages/**/*.md', { eager: true, query: '?raw', import: 'default' })

import boot from 'pages/boot'
import pages from 'pages'

export default buildMessages({ langModules, mdModules, pages, boot })

Language files

Place HJSON locale files in src/i18n/languages/:

src/i18n/languages/en-US.hjson
src/i18n/languages/pt-BR.hjson

Search tags (src/i18n/tags.hjson)

Provide search keywords per route and locale for menu search:

{
  "en-US": {
    "/manual/my-section/my-page": "keyword1 keyword2 keyword3"
  }
  "pt-BR": {
    "/manual/my-section/my-page": "palavra1 palavra2 palavra3"
  }
}

📁 Consumer Project Structure

my-docs/
├── docsector.config.js        # Branding, links, languages
├── quasar.config.js           # Thin wrapper using createQuasarConfig()
├── package.json
├── src/
│   ├── pages/
│   │   ├── index.js           # Page registry (routes + metadata)
│   │   ├── boot.js            # Boot page data
│   │   ├── guide/             # Guide pages (.md files)
│   │   └── manual/            # Manual pages (.md files)
│   ├── i18n/
│   │   ├── index.js           # Uses buildMessages() from engine
│   │   ├── tags.hjson         # Search keywords per route/locale
│   │   └── languages/         # HJSON locale files
│   ├── css/
│   │   └── app.sass           # Optional overrides (imports engine CSS)
│   └── boot/                  # Consumer-specific boot files
│       └── qmediaplayer.js    # Example: custom Quasar extension
└── public/
    ├── images/logo/           # Project logo
    ├── images/flags/          # Locale flag images
    └── icons/                 # PWA icons

📄 Adding Pages

1️⃣ Register in src/pages/index.js:

export default {
  '/manual/my-section/my-page': {
    config: {
      icon: 'description',
      status: 'done',        // 'done' | 'draft' | 'empty'
      type: 'manual',        // 'guide' | 'manual'
      menu: {
        header: { label: '.my-section', icon: 'category' }
      },
      subpages: { showcase: false, vs: false }
    },
    data: {
      'en-US': { title: 'My Page' },
      'pt-BR': { title: 'Minha Página' }
    }
  }
}

2️⃣ Create Markdown files:

src/pages/manual/my-section/my-page.overview.en-US.md
src/pages/manual/my-section/my-page.overview.pt-BR.md

🖥️ CLI Commands

docsector init <name>          # Scaffold a new consumer project
docsector dev                  # Start dev server (port 8181)
docsector dev --port 3000      # Custom port
docsector build                # Build for production (dist/spa/)
docsector serve                # Serve production build
docsector help                 # Show help

🔌 Exports

| Import path | Export | Description | |---|---|---| | @docsector/docsector-reader/quasar-factory | createQuasarConfig() | Config factory for consumer projects | | @docsector/docsector-reader/quasar-factory | configure() | No-op wrapper (avoids needing quasar dep) | | @docsector/docsector-reader/i18n | buildMessages() | Build i18n messages from globs + pages | | @docsector/docsector-reader/i18n | filter() | Filter i18n messages by locale |


🛠️ Tech Stack

| Technology | Purpose | |---|---| | Vue 3 | Composition API + <script setup> | | Quasar v2 | UI framework | | @quasar/app-vite | Vite-based Quasar build | | Vuex 4 | State management | | vue-i18n 9 | Internationalization | | markdown-it | Markdown parsing | | Prism.js | Syntax highlighting | | HJSON | Human-friendly JSON for locale files |
